Overview of Automatically Generated ResultsQuantities automatically computed by MagNet's solvers include:
| Energy | Flux Linkage |
| Force | Torque |
| Power Loss | Stored Energy |
| Voltage | Current |
Field quantities automatically determined include:
| Current Density (J) | Energy Density |
| Vector Magnetic Flux Density (B) | Vector Magnetic Field Intensity (H) |
| Ohmic Loss | Lorentz Force Density (JxB) |
| Relative Reluctivity |
These field quantities can be visualized on the surface or a specified internal cross section of the component. There are three types of field plot views: Contour, Shaded and Arrow.
Certain types of simulations require multi-step problem solutions. These types of problems include models with:
- time varying solutions
- parameterized variables
- Motion
